TAL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2020 in Review

350 of the 4,956 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in TAL Education Group (TAL) for Q3 2020, worth a combined $26.5B — up 12% from $23.6B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 39 funds opened new TAL positions and 37 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 122 added to existing stakes and 140 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$562M. The largest seller was HHLR Advisors, cutting an estimated $286M.
